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Zeilenumbrüche entfernen (https://www.delphipraxis.net/19752-zeilenumbrueche-entfernen.html)

Florian H 8. Apr 2004 09:54


Zeilenumbrüche entfernen
 
Hallo,

wie kann ich einen Text von einem TStringList in ein anderes einfügen und dabei die Zeilenumbrüche weglassen?

Ich hätte da an sowas gedacht
Delphi-Quellcode:
  text := stringlist1.text;
  while pos(#13, text) <> 0 do
    text[pos(#13, text)] := ' ';
  stringlist2.add(text);
Aber da sind die Zeilenumbrüche noch drin.
Wohl wegen dem #13....

was tun?

grüße
flo

s14 8. Apr 2004 09:59

Re: Zeilenumbrüche entfernen
 
ein Zeilenumbruch besteht meistens aus zwei Zeichen #13#10 :!:

Es gibt auch noch irgendwo die Funktion StringReplace oder so ähnlich.

Florian H 8. Apr 2004 10:07

Re: Zeilenumbrüche entfernen
 
Hm stimmt.
Aber mit StringReplace geht es irgendwie auch nicht...

Robert_G 8. Apr 2004 10:07

Re: Zeilenumbrüche entfernen
 
Hast du überhaupt versucht nach [dp]Zeilenümbrüche[/dp] zu suchen :?: :?: :?:
Da findest du zum Bsp. : Wie alle zeilenumbrüche löschen?

Das dürfte INHO auch bei dir passen, rate mal welchen Typ TMemo.Lines hat.

MathiasSimmack 8. Apr 2004 10:09

Re: Zeilenumbrüche entfernen
 
Zitat:

Zitat von Florian H
Hm stimmt.
Aber mit StringReplace geht es irgendwie auch nicht...

Natürlich nicht ... denn du hast garantiert nicht bedacht, dass StringReplace eine Funktion ist. :roll:

Florian H 8. Apr 2004 10:12

Re: Zeilenumbrüche entfernen
 
:duck:

Ich hab das Forum durchsucht, aber nix gefunden...wahr wohl der falsche suchbegriff...

@MathiasSimmack: ähh...nein. DANKE!

Jetzt gehts.


Alle Zeitangaben in WEZ +1. Es ist jetzt 11:22 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z